c44f27284e
Now that the os_trove role is integrated, this should be in the docs. Change-Id: I943b25c9fd3a2dda85016419c8a6737dc014f47d
95 lines
3.3 KiB
ReStructuredText
95 lines
3.3 KiB
ReStructuredText
.. _role-docs:
|
|
|
|
==============================
|
|
Advanced service configuration
|
|
==============================
|
|
|
|
OpenStack-Ansible has many options that you can use for the advanced
|
|
configuration of services. Each role's documentation provides information
|
|
about the available options.
|
|
|
|
The following options are optional.
|
|
|
|
Infrastructure service roles
|
|
~~~~~~~~~~~~~~~~~~~~~~~~~~~~
|
|
|
|
- `galera_server <http://docs.openstack.org/developer/openstack-ansible-galera_server>`_
|
|
|
|
- `haproxy_server <http://docs.openstack.org/developer/openstack-ansible-haproxy_server>`_
|
|
|
|
- `memcached_server <http://docs.openstack.org/developer/openstack-ansible-memcached_server>`_
|
|
|
|
- `rabbitmq_server <http://docs.openstack.org/developer/openstack-ansible-rabbitmq_server>`_
|
|
|
|
- `repo_build <http://docs.openstack.org/developer/openstack-ansible-repo_build>`_
|
|
|
|
- `repo_server <http://docs.openstack.org/developer/openstack-ansible-repo_server>`_
|
|
|
|
- `rsyslog_server <http://docs.openstack.org/developer/openstack-ansible-rsyslog_server>`_
|
|
|
|
|
|
OpenStack service roles
|
|
~~~~~~~~~~~~~~~~~~~~~~~
|
|
|
|
- `os_aodh <http://docs.openstack.org/developer/openstack-ansible-os_aodh>`_
|
|
|
|
- `os_ceilometer <http://docs.openstack.org/developer/openstack-ansible-os_ceilometer>`_
|
|
|
|
- `os_cinder <http://docs.openstack.org/developer/openstack-ansible-os_cinder>`_
|
|
|
|
- `os_glance <http://docs.openstack.org/developer/openstack-ansible-os_glance>`_
|
|
|
|
- `os_gnocchi <http://docs.openstack.org/developer/openstack-ansible-os_gnocchi>`_
|
|
|
|
- `os_heat <http://docs.openstack.org/developer/openstack-ansible-os_heat>`_
|
|
|
|
- `os_horizon <http://docs.openstack.org/developer/openstack-ansible-os_horizon>`_
|
|
|
|
- `os_ironic <http://docs.openstack.org/developer/openstack-ansible-os_ironic>`_
|
|
|
|
- `os_keystone <http://docs.openstack.org/developer/openstack-ansible-os_keystone>`_
|
|
|
|
- `os_magnum <http://docs.openstack.org/developer/openstack-ansible-os_magnum>`_
|
|
|
|
- `os_neutron <http://docs.openstack.org/developer/openstack-ansible-os_neutron>`_
|
|
|
|
- `os_nova <http://docs.openstack.org/developer/openstack-ansible-os_nova>`_
|
|
|
|
- `os_rally <http://docs.openstack.org/developer/openstack-ansible-os_rally>`_
|
|
|
|
- `os_sahara <http://docs.openstack.org/developer/openstack-ansible-os_sahara>`_
|
|
|
|
- `os_swift <http://docs.openstack.org/developer/openstack-ansible-os_swift>`_
|
|
|
|
- `os_tempest <http://docs.openstack.org/developer/openstack-ansible-os_tempest>`_
|
|
|
|
- `os_trove <http://docs.openstack.org/developer/openstack-ansible-os_trove>`_
|
|
|
|
|
|
Other roles
|
|
~~~~~~~~~~~
|
|
|
|
- `ansible-plugins <http://docs.openstack.org/developer/openstack-ansible-plugins>`_
|
|
|
|
- `apt_package_pinning <http://docs.openstack.org/developer/openstack-ansible-apt_package_pinning/>`_
|
|
|
|
- `ceph_client <http://docs.openstack.org/developer/openstack-ansible-ceph_client>`_
|
|
|
|
- `galera_client <http://docs.openstack.org/developer/openstack-ansible-galera_client>`_
|
|
|
|
- `lxc_container_create <http://docs.openstack.org/developer/openstack-ansible-lxc_container_create>`_
|
|
|
|
- `lxc_hosts <http://docs.openstack.org/developer/openstack-ansible-lxc_hosts>`_
|
|
|
|
- `pip_install <http://docs.openstack.org/developer/openstack-ansible-pip_install/>`_
|
|
|
|
- `openstack_openrc <http://docs.openstack.org/developer/openstack-ansible-openstack_openrc>`_
|
|
|
|
- `openstack_hosts <http://docs.openstack.org/developer/openstack-ansible-openstack_hosts>`_
|
|
|
|
- `rsyslog_client <http://docs.openstack.org/developer/openstack-ansible-rsyslog_client>`_
|
|
|
|
|
|
|
|
|